London City Lionesses make history by announcing Arsenal sell-out

London City Lionesses have created another piece of history after announcing the news that this weekend’s Barclays Women’s Super League fixture against Arsenal has sold out.

The Pride play host to The Gunners at The Copperjax Community Stadium on Sunday afternoon.

WSL Full-Time were informed by London City Lionesses that the game has sold out earlier today. It is the first time that The Pride have sold out a home fixture in the Barclays Women’s Super League and the first time that they have filled their 6,100-capacity home at The Copperjax Community Stadium in Bromley.

Commenting after the final tickets were snapped up, London City Lionesses attacker Nikita Parris said “It’s a massive achievement for the club to sell out
at Bromley for the first time in its history. The fans are so important to us as players and really help galvanise us as a team. They’re our twelfth player and we really need that energy for the Arsenal game and going forward.

“We want to give everything for London City to push this team forward. We’re going in the right direction. I’ve only been here since the summer but the project has already grown so much.

“We want to see the fans loud and proud. We need their help and support, first stop is Arsenal and the second stop is Chelsea.”

London City Lionesses’ Barclays Women’s Super League fixture against Arsenal kicks-off at 11.55am on Sunday.
